Salmonberry is a shrub that grows along the West Coast of North America.

The fruit of the salmonberry is edible, and has a flavour that is a mix of raspberry and strawberry.

Salmonberry is common in temperate rainforests, where it thrives in acidic soils. The plant has been used by indigenous peoples for food and medicine.

Geeky Facts about the Salmonberry

Fact 1

Salmonberry has been a part of the Alaskan indigenous peoples’ diet for thousands of years.

Fact 2

Salmonberry has also been used to flavor beer and wine.

Fact 3

Salmonberries are known to be an excellent source of vitamins C and K, and manganese.
